BENEFITS

  • Cut resistance according to EN 388:2016 level B, water and oil repellent palm, non-steel, non-fiberglass
  • Prevents the risk of injury from cuts, scratches, lacerations, contact with dirt, contact with oil and grease

APPLICATIONS

  • Dry environments, dirty environments
  • Main areas of use: precision assembly, assembly, inspection work, machinery handling, installation work, warehouse work, metal sector work, repairs
  • Main use sectors: pulp and paper, rubber and plastic, metal fabrication, machinery and equipment, MRO, automotive, transportation, logistics
  • Type of work: light handling
